About the course
This graduate certificate is designed for qualified primary or secondary teachers who want to extend their qualifications into early childhood education (birth to pre-primary/age 8). It leads to an ACECQA-recognised qualification and is structured to suit working teachers, with practicums scheduled in school holidays or within your own workplace where applicable. The Graduate Certificate in early childhood teaching can be completed in 8 months. Career outcome
Graduates can work in early childhood education settings with children from birth to eight years, including early learning services and the early years of schooling. The course supports teachers seeking to broaden their scope into early childhood roles and can strengthen pathways into pedagogical leadership and school leadership opportunities.
